OK I know that this matter is widely discussed already but I am at a loss... Got a 9700K yesterday on an Asus ROG Z390 H Gaming with the latest bios version, dated yesterday. With default settings or auto or whatever, the CPU doesn't go beyond 3.9GHz in any Windows situation (gaming, AIDA64 etc). I have tried -almost- anything in BIOS disabled and enabled all the relevant options (asus multicore, 5G OC setting, TPU, C states etc), the only thing that seems to work is disabling SpeedStep and Speed Shift options which allows the CPU to work -constantly though- at 4.6GHz max. 4.9 or 5GHz are out of the question I don't know if there is any way to see these numbers. For starters I only want boost to work as intended and not get the stupid limit of 3.9GHz. Hell, my i7 4790 boosted at 4GHz... Any suggestions or ideas are welcome.

i had similar issue after upgrade from z170 & 7700k without clean windows installation, in my case cpu frequency did not go below 3,6 GHz while idling

rjbarker
Level 11
Changing Mobo and CPU = should always be clean OS install ......I also don't consider "cloning" as a "clean install".....

Yup, it was Windows after all... Clean install solved all issues.
